public class JAXBHelperContext
extends SDOHelperContext

The JAXBHelperContext is a bridge between POJOs and SDO DataObjects. The bridge is based on their corresponding XML representations. For the POJOs the XML representation is specified using JAXB annotations or object-to-XML mappings.

The following steps are required to create the JAXBHelperContext. The XML schema used in step #3 is the same one that the POJOs are mapped to. This step has been separated so that SDO annotations could be added to the XML schema.

Step #1 - Create the JAXBContext

 JAXBContext jaxbContext = JAXBContext.newInstance("com.example.customer");
 

Step #2 - Create the JAXBHelperContext

 JAXBHelperContext jaxbHelperContext = new JAXBHelperContext(jaxbContext);
 

Step #3 - Create the SDO Metadata from an XML Schema

 jaxbHelperContext.getXSDHelper().define(xmlSchema);
 

The JAXBHelperContext allows you to convert between POJOs and DataObjects using a wrap operation.

 Customer customer = new Customer();
 Address address new Address();
 address.setStreet("123 Any Street");
 customer.set(address);
 
 DataObject customerDO = jaxbHelperContext.wrap(customer);
 customerDO.getString("address/street");  // returns "123 Any Street"
 

The JAXBHelperContext allows you to convert between DataObjects and POJOs using an unwrap operation.

 Type customerType = jaxbHelperContext.getType(Customer.class);
 DataObject customerDO = jaxbHelperContext.getDataFactory().create(customerType);
 customerDO.set("first-name", "Jane");
 
 Customer customer = jaxbHelperContext.unwrap(customerDO);
 customer.getFirstName();  // returns "Jane"
 

Of course the POJOs may be JPA entities. Below is an example of wrapping the results of a JPA query.

 EntityManagerFactory emf = Persistence.createEntityManagerFactory("CustomerExample");      
 EntityManager em = emf.createEntityManager();
 List entities = em.createQuery("SELECT e FROM MyEntity e WHERE ...").getResultList();
 List dataObjects = hc.wrap(entities);

wrap

public DataObject wrap(java.lang.Object entity)
Return a DataObject that wraps a POJO. This call should be made on the root POJO.
 Customer customer = new Customer();
 Address address new Address();
 address.setStreet("123 Any Street");
 customer.set(address);
 
 DataObject customerDO = jaxbHelperContext.wrap(customer);
 customerDO.getString("address/street");  // returns "123 Any Street"
 
Multiple calls to wrap for the same instance POJO return the same instance of DataObject, in other words the following is always true:
 jaxbHelperContext.wrap(customer123) == jaxbHelperContext.wrap(customer123)
 jaxbHelperContext.wrap(customer123) != jaxbHelperContext.wrap(customer456)

unwrap

public java.lang.Object unwrap(DataObject dataObject)
Return the POJO that is wrapped by the DataObject.
 Type customerType = jaxbHelperContext.getType(Customer.class);
 DataObject customerDO = jaxbHelperContext.getDataFactory().create(customerType);
 DataObject addressDO = customerDO.create("address");
 addressDO.set("street", "123 Any Street");
 
 Customer customer = (Customer) jaxbHelperContext.unwrap(customerDO);
 customer.getAddress().getStreet();  // returns "123 Any Street"
 
Multiple calls to unwrap for the same DataObject must return the same instance of Object, in other words the following is always true:
 jaxbHelperContext.unwrap(customerDO123) == jaxbHelperContext.unwrap(customerDO123)
 jaxbHelperContext.unwrap(customerDO123) != jaxbHelperContext.unwrap(customerDO456)
 customer123 == jaxbHelperContext.unwrap(jaxbHelperContext.wrap(customer123))
